    • TRANSPARENT TELEVISION LIMITED

      Nov 2016 - Nov 2016
      Peter Burns, The Last Interview

      Obituary TV programme on the late Peter Burns. With short notice I had to pick up a car, kit and an assistant producer and drive to Pete Waterman's house. There I lit and shot an in depth interview with Pete chronicling the life of his former friend and colleague Peter Burns. Whilst directing two camera's I had to get Pete to talk about very serious and personal issues whilst monitoring sound and planning for an edit.

    • Barcroft Media

      Nov 2016 - Nov 2016
      Dave The Baker

      WIth a producer I directed and shot the footage for this taster tape. The purpose was a series pitch for Barcroft Media with Dave Smart who runs Greenhalgh bakers and appeared on This Morning. I had to follow him as he gave us a tour, creating a narrative as we went, filming processes, directing staff. At the end of the day I had to quickly recce, shoot and light several interviews with key staff in fading light.

    • Kudos Film and Television

      Mar 2017 - Mar 2017
      Shooting PD

      I shot promotional material for the BBC's 'Gunpowder' series. Shooting around a working film set meant after initial equipment preparation and scheduling, I had to adapt as the main crew's schedules changed; hours spent lighting an interview would be lost as celebrities became available elsewhere at short notice. I had to be resourceful and prepared for any eventuality, to adapt without compromising quality and creativity. http://www.bbc.co.uk/programmes/p05lxrxl

    • Skeleton Productions

      Sept 2017 - Sept 2017
      Mangar USA

      I created shot lists and schedules for this two day shoot with actors.The aim was to create a B2B promo demonstrating an inflatable device to get old people on their feet after a fall in a care home. We shot in a working care home so aside from the usual location considerations such as sunlight, extraneous noise etc we had frail members of the community who were also paying customers not wishing to have their daily routine disturbed. I had to remain calm and always have at least one plan B in my head for every scenario. Show less
